What is the legal definition of money laundering in Costa Rica?

Money laundering in Costa Rica is defined as the process of hiding or disguising the illicit origin of goods or money, so that it appears legitimate. It is considered a serious crime in Costa Rican legislation.

Are there any restrictions on access to judicial files in Costa Rica?

Although the "Access to Public Information Law" guarantees access to judicial files in Costa Rica, there are restrictions. For example, information related to national security, party privacy, or confidential matters may be subject to restrictions. The judge or judicial authority has the discretion to determine whether certain information should be kept confidential.

What are the due diligence measures that financial entities in Peru must follow?

Financial entities in Peru must implement due diligence measures to identify and know their clients. This involves obtaining verifiable information about the identity of clients, assessing the risk of money laundering, monitoring transactions carried out and reporting any suspicious activity to the FIU.

What is the procedure to apply for a residence visa for foreign spouses of Chilean citizens in Chile?

The process to apply for a residence visa for foreign spouses of Chilean citizens in Chile involves complying with certain requirements and procedures. You must submit an application to the Chilean Consulate in your country of origin or residence, attaching the required documents, such as a marriage certificate, criminal record certificates, proof of financial means, among others. You must also pay the corresponding fees. The Immigration Department will evaluate your application and, if approved, you will receive the residence visa for foreign spouses of Chilean citizens, which will allow you to reside in Chile with your Chilean spouse.
